So many women wonder if they ought to work with a wedding planner. Would they require a complete plan or will a partial service do. If they have got negotiated with a venue, will the venue coordinator fill wedding ceremony consultant's role? Can a pal or relative fill out? Learning the perspective and roles of each one will assist to decide easier. Begin with investigating when each enters the marriage planning picture. The venue would be the first vendor booked. Representatives could possibly be titled Director of Sales, Catering Manager, Banquet Manager and many other variations. This sounds very alluring since it looks like two services for the price of one, but be mindful. Many venues within the DC area experience high turnover and it's also possible to work multiple contacts. Sometimes the changeover is close to the date for your wedding and all of a sudden. With each incoming contact, discussions and outline have to be rehashed to obtain the new person up to speed. It is usually a direct result venue/catering turnover that some brides will search for a coordinator.


A day/month of coordinator will step up close to the end when the client has created each of the vendor, time-line, and guest list decisions. They might be hired a few months ahead of the actual event while in others, these are hired near the date for your wedding. Associated with pension transfer other vendors, booking early will ensure the opportunity to interview several and hire the top match in your ideas and personality. Partial planning services could be hired from the beginning to assistance with the selection of vendors and contract negotiation but enable the bride to take the remaining portion of the intending on by herself. They could be earned mid-way through the planning by brides who planned to handle all arrangements themselves but later seen that the position has my head spinning. Many companies offer a la carte services such as pick-up, delivery and return of rental items and clothing; invitation assembly and mailing; creation and delivery of hotel guest bags; vendor contract negotiation; and budgeting advice which can are available in to learn at different times. Full service planners usually are contacted right from the start to help with venue selection and vendor contracts although sometimes to follow the selection of the ceremony and reception venue or another vendor how the client feels strongly about. When created later, that may place their service level more within the partial or possibly a la carte planning category.
